Suzuki eyes closer cooperation with Fiat

Published Updated

Suzuki Motor Corp could deepen its co-operation with Fiat amidst a rift with German partner Volkswagen, a German magazine reported on Saturday. "The co-operation with Fiat has been working well for years. It is easy to imagine that deepening the partnership would be of benefit to both sides," Automobilwoche cited a high-ranking Suzuki executive as saying in a copy of a report ahead of publication.
Relations between Suzuki and VW showed signs of souring this week with Suzuki Executive Vice President Yasuhito Harayama asserting the company's independence and saying the two needed to go back to the drawing board on their partnership.
